Definitions from Wiktionary (blood libel)
▸ noun: (conspiracy theories) The false, anti-Semitic accusation that Jews abduct and murder non-Jewish children to use their blood for their religious rituals and holidays.
▸ noun: (by extension) Any false or purportedly false accusation of murder of a non-Jew by a Jewish person or organization.
▸ noun: (by extension) Any false or purportedly false accusation of guilt, especially of guilt in mass murder or homicide.
▸ noun: More generally, any canard or virulent lie about someone.
